A hospital administration would like to know the average length that a patient stays in the hospital. It would be almost impossible to look through all of the past records and average the lengths of stay. Instead, a sample of 1000 patients over the last year was randomly chosen and their lengths of stay were averaged. Describe the population and sample in this problem.

Population

The entire group of individuals or instances about whom we hope to learn in a statistical analysis.

Sample

A subset of a larger population selected for measurement, observation, or questioning to make inferences about the whole.
